Did they ever start harvesting oysters out of Apalachicola bay again?
There are farms at Indian Pass and around St. George Island, and maybe other spots that are growing and selling them. Still have 2-3 years before the wild beds open back up.


Why were they closed?

I think the numbers got too low for various reasons. Back during the oil spill they thought the oil would wipe them out so they allowed them to harvest as much as they could. Also, the ongoing dispute over the amount of water coming down the chattahochee from Atlanta. I think even now they are struggling with lack of proper environment for them to grow.
